Huntington Federal Savings Bank, often referred to as Huntington Bank, is a prominent financial institution headquartered in the United States. Established in 1899, the bank has a rich history of serving communities across key operational regions, including Ohio, West Virginia, and Pennsylvania. As a member of the banking industry, Huntington Federal Savings Bank focuses on providing a range of core products and services, including personal banking, business loans, and mortgage solutions. What sets Huntington apart is its commitment to customer service and community engagement, fostering long-term relationships with clients. With a strong market position, Huntington has achieved notable milestones, including recognition for its innovative banking solutions and community involvement. The bank continues to evolve, ensuring it meets the diverse needs of its customers while maintaining a solid reputation in the financial sector.

Huntington Federal Savings Bank's reported carbon emissions

Huntington Federal Savings Bank currently does not report any carbon emissions data, as indicated by the absence of specific figures in kg CO2e. Additionally, there are no documented reduction targets or climate pledges associated with the bank. This lack of data suggests that Huntington Federal Savings Bank may not have established formal climate commitments or initiatives aimed at reducing its carbon footprint. In the context of the banking industry, many institutions are increasingly adopting sustainability practices and setting science-based targets to mitigate climate change impacts. However, without specific emissions data or commitments, it is unclear how Huntington Federal Savings Bank aligns with these industry trends. As the bank continues to operate, it may consider developing a comprehensive climate strategy to enhance transparency and contribute to broader environmental goals.

Huntington Federal Savings Bank's Climate Goals (2030 & 2050)

Climate goals typically focus on 2030 interim targets and 2050 net-zero commitments, aligned with global frameworks like the Paris Agreement and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) to ensure alignment with global climate goals.

Huntington Federal Savings Bank has not publicly committed to specific 2030 or 2050 climate goals through the major frameworks we track. Companies often set interim 2030 targets and long-term 2050 net-zero goals to demonstrate measurable progress toward decarbonization.
